Output 8bfb680890df71554edbeb3261ba75523c1795141bb911951f8c645256a87450:1

value
3842567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d831f3562a3588eb80a36e196eb91ed8ee4baa7 OP_EQUAL
address
MU6QeLMv95FSt5uAQSqXkQ2NKJPgLR5fDN
transaction
8bfb680890df71554edbeb3261ba75523c1795141bb911951f8c645256a87450
spent
true